SEO Strategies for Franchise and Multi-Location Businesses
SEO Strategies for Franchise and Multi-Location Businesses
Scaling a business across multiple cities changes everything about search visibility. What works for a single-location company rarely works for a franchise system with ten, fifty, or two hundred branches. Competing in multiple markets requires layered authority, local relevance, brand consistency, and technical precision — all operating simultaneously. In today’s search landscape, multi-location growth depends on a unified yet flexible Search Engine Optimization strategy built to scale without fragmenting visibility.
Franchise and multi-location SEO is not simply about duplicating pages with different city names. It requires infrastructure — technical architecture, content localization, citation control, entity clarity, and performance tracking across diverse geographic territories. Businesses that execute this correctly dominate both map results and organic listings. Those that don’t often cannibalize their own rankings.
This guide explores advanced SEO strategies specifically designed for franchise systems and multi-location brands that want scalable, sustainable market dominance.
Understanding the Unique SEO Challenges of Franchise Models
Franchise systems face structural SEO challenges that single-location businesses rarely encounter. These include:
- Duplicate content across locations
- Brand consistency versus local customization
- Competing service areas within close proximity
- Decentralized marketing control
- Review management at scale
Without strategic coordination, franchise locations may:
- Compete against each other for identical keywords
- Create inconsistent NAP (Name, Address, Phone) signals
- Dilute domain authority
- Lose map pack stability
The key is balancing centralized authority with localized optimization. A well-structured system ensures that each location strengthens the parent brand rather than fragmenting it.
Building a Scalable Website Architecture
Proper site structure is foundational. Multi-location websites typically follow one of these models:
- Subfolders (domain.com/city/)
- Subdomains (city.domain.com)
- Separate domains per franchisee
Subfolders are generally preferred because they consolidate domain authority while allowing local optimization.
| Structure | Authority Consolidation | Ease of Management |
|---|---|---|
| Subfolder | High | High |
| Subdomain | Medium | Medium |
| Separate Domain | Low | Low |
Each location page should include:
- Unique localized content
- Embedded Google Map
- Location-specific testimonials
- Structured data markup
Avoid templated duplication. Google’s systems detect near-identical pages quickly.
Preventing Keyword Cannibalization Across Locations
Keyword cannibalization occurs when multiple pages compete for the same search term. In multi-location environments, this is common.
To prevent overlap:
- Assign primary keywords by geography
- Create city-specific modifiers
- Build supporting localized blog clusters
- Use internal linking strategically
For example:
- “Emergency Plumbing Dallas” targets Dallas page
- “Emergency Plumbing Fort Worth” targets Fort Worth page
Clear keyword segmentation protects ranking stability.
Optimizing Google Business Profiles at Scale
Google Business Profile management becomes exponentially complex with scale.
Key elements:
- Consistent branding across all listings
- Unique descriptions per location
- Accurate service areas
- Review response protocols
A coordinated local SEO system ensures:
- Each branch ranks independently
- Map pack visibility expands across regions
- Reputation signals strengthen entity trust
Central dashboards combined with localized management produce optimal results.
Creating Unique Localized Content for Each Market
Location pages should not simply swap city names. Instead, include:
- Neighborhood references
- Community involvement highlights
- Case studies from that city
- Local event participation
This strengthens relevance signals and builds topical authority within each geographic entity.
Managing Reviews and Reputation Across Locations
Review velocity influences local rankings. At scale:
- Implement automated review request systems
- Train franchisees on response guidelines
- Monitor sentiment trends by region
Higher review consistency strengthens both organic and map pack performance.
Structured Data for Multi-Location Clarity
Schema markup clarifies:
- Parent organization
- Branch locations
- Service offerings
- Geographic coverage
Entity clarity reduces confusion and strengthens brand authority signals.
Backlink Strategy for Franchise Systems
Multi-location brands should pursue:
- National authority backlinks
- Regional partnerships
- Local sponsorship links
- Industry citations
Centralized link acquisition combined with local outreach builds layered authority.
Advanced organic SEO for franchises requires both macro and micro-level authority building.
Tracking Performance Across Markets
Franchise systems must monitor:
- Keyword rankings by city
- Map pack presence
- Conversion rates per location
- Revenue per organic visitor
Dashboards should segment performance geographically to identify underperforming territories.
Balancing Central Control with Local Autonomy
Successful franchise SEO requires:
- Centralized technical oversight
- Brand consistency enforcement
- Localized content flexibility
- Clear communication channels
A hybrid structure protects authority while allowing each branch to compete effectively in its own market.
Scaling Sustainable Visibility Across Every Location
Franchise and multi-location SEO is a structural strategy, not a one-time campaign. When properly implemented, each branch strengthens the parent entity while building independent visibility in its local market.
If your franchise system is ready to scale rankings, map pack dominance, and organic authority across multiple territories, GetPhound builds integrated SEO infrastructures designed specifically for multi-location growth.












